Selection of various wood species in Maryland custom cabinetry
Maryland Custom Woodwork Cabinetry often features a wide array of wood species, each presenting unique aesthetic and performance characteristics for kitchen and other woodwork applications. Homeowners looking bespoke designs can choose from both hardwoods custom woodwork design and softwoods, influencing the final look and durability of their custom cabinetry.
The selection of wood for Custom Woodwork Cabinetry significantly influences kitchen design. Popular options include maple, cherry, and hickory for their hardness and differing grain patterns. White oak and red oak are commonly used for their distinct grain, while alder and walnut offer rich, distinctive hues. Silver maple furnishes a lighter alternative. For internal structures and stability, high-grade plywood is a common material in professional woodworking and carpentry, ensuring the longevity of the finished millwork in kitchens and beyond.
Crucial core building in modern custom wood cabinetry
Current Custom Woodwork Cabinetry depends on several core construction methods to guarantee durability and aesthetic attractiveness. The predominant techniques include face-frame and frameless construction, each presenting separate advantages in regards of structural solidity and design flexibility for custom cabinets. Face-frame construction employs a solid wood frame attached to the front of the cabinet box, providing a traditional aesthetic and sturdy support for doors and drawers. This method is often selected for its classic look and skill to blend various styles of doors and decorative elements into the overall Custom Woodwork Cabinetry design.
Alternatively, frameless, or European-style, Custom Woodwork Cabinetry utilizes thicker cabinet boxes where doors and drawer fronts attach directly to the box, maximizing interior storage space and attaining a sleek, up-to-date appearance. This approach is highly effective for modern designs, providing full admittance to the cabinet interior without the hindrance of a face frame, which is suitable for optimizing the functionality of custom storage. Both methods demand precision in joinery, with dovetail and dado joints being typical for guaranteeing the longevity of drawer boxes and overall furniture-grade construction. The choice between these methods significantly influences the concluding look and utility of any Custom Woodwork Cabinetry project, showcasing the versatility of wood products in creating bespoke living spaces.
